Comprehending the procedure associated with a private ADHD assessment can help individuals and families prepare. Below are the common steps included:
Initial Consultation: This meeting is a chance to discuss signs and worry about a health care professional. The clinician will assess whether an ADHD examination is needed.
Clinical Evaluation: The clinician will carry out a comprehensive scientific assessment, which normally consists of:
Questionnaires: Standardized score scales offered to the private and their household members.Interviews: In-depth discussions regarding the individual's history, family background, and everyday life difficulties.Behavioral Observations: The clinician may observe the person in different settings, such as in the house or in a school-like environment.
Psychometric Testing: Various standardized tests may be used to evaluate cognitive capabilities, attention period, memory, and executive functioning skills. This information will assist develop a clearer image of any potential ADHD signs.
Diagnosis and Feedback: Following the assessment, the clinician will provide feedback detailing the findings. If diagnosed with ADHD, they will detail treatment choices and techniques.
Follow-Up: Continuous assistance through follow-up consultations may be arranged to guarantee that treatment plans work and to make needed adjustments.
Expenses and Financial Considerations
The cost of a private ADHD assessment can vary substantially based upon geographical area, the center's track record, and the assessment's comprehensiveness. Here's a breakdown of possible costs:
Expense TypeEstimated CostPreliminary Consultation₤ 100 - ₤ 300Comprehensive Evaluation₤ 800 - ₤ 2,000Psychometric TestingVaries, generally ₤ 200 - ₤ 800Follow-Up Sessions₤ 75 - ₤ 250 per session
Individuals ought to ask about payment strategies, insurance protection, and whether the center offers any financial support choices.
